Fuse Energy is a fast-growing renewables startup seeking a Talent Sourcer to scale our hiring engine.

You will identify, engage, and nurture top candidates across technical, expansions, hardware, product, and operations roles.

You will map talent pools, maintain pipelines in our ATS, and coordinate interviews across time zones while partnering with recruiters and hiring managers to prioritise roles and refine search strategies in a vibrant, fast-paced environment.

How to prepare for a job interview at Fuse Energy, LLC

Know Your Sourcing Strategies

In the talent acquisition world, it’s all about knowing the best sourcing strategies. Be prepared to discuss specific techniques you’ve used to find and attract top talent, whether that’s through social media, networking events, or innovative outreach methods. Bring examples that showcase your capability!

Value of Employer Branding

Employer branding is a huge part of recruitment, so be ready to chat about how you’ve contributed to building an attractive company image. Think about how you’d pitch Fuse Energy, LLC to potential candidates and maintain a consistent brand image across platforms.

Demonstrate Your Interviewing Skills

Since this is a full-time gig, hiring managers will want to see your interviewing prowess. Prepare for mock interview scenarios where you might need to assess candidates' cultural fit and skill set. Practise asking competency-based questions to demonstrate your systematic approach.

Engage with Data and Metrics

Being data-driven is key in talent acquisition! Expect to discuss how you’ve used recruiting metrics to refine your strategies. Familiarise yourself with common KPIs, like time-to-fill and candidate satisfaction scores, and be ready to back up your insights with data!
